Inpatient Registered Nurse (RN) - Wound CareHealogics is the largest provider of advanced wound care services in the United States, treating more than 300,000 chronic wound patients annually across over 600 sites.
With an aging society, obesity and diabetes on the rise, and an uptick in surgical procedures, the number of patients with non-healing wounds that would benefit from expert care is dramatically increasing.
As a result, the company is working to provide our differentiated, quality outcomes to as many patients that would benefit through our out-patient clinic partnerships.
The Wound Care and Ostomy Nurse will primarily provide clinical evaluation and the initial plan of care for inpatient wound and ostomy services and provide nursing support to the outpatient Wound Care Center (WCC), if needed.
The individual in this role will provide consultation, educational, knowledge, skills and support of the bedside nurse to manage patients at risk for pressure injury development, as well as patients with wounds and/or ostomies and educational services to patients and their family members to assist them in the management of their individual wound care and ostomy needs.
The Wound Care and Ostomy Nurse will report to the Program Director of the Wound Care Center (WCC), as well as maintaining a dotted line reporting structure to the Senior Director of Inpatient Services with Healogics.
The responsibility and accountability for day-to-day patient care will continue to rest with the individual nurse responsible for the patient, unit-based resource nurses and the Nurse Manager of each unit.
